Robinhood is a popular trading platform that allows users to buy and sell stocks, options, and cryptocurrencies with ease. However, like any online service, it is not immune to technical glitches. One of the most frustrating issues users encounter is a "Server Error" message, which can prevent access to their accounts and disrupt trading activities. If you’re facing this problem, here’s a guide to understanding and resolving it.
Common Causes of Robinhood Server Errors
- Server Outages: Sometimes, Robinhood experiences downtime due to maintenance or unexpected technical failures.
- High Traffic Load: During periods of high trading activity, such as major market movements or IPO releases, the platform can become overloaded.
- App or Website Issues: Bugs in the Robinhood app or web interface may cause errors in connectivity.
- Internet Connectivity Problems: A weak or unstable internet connection can lead to server errors.
- Account Issues: Occasionally, specific account-related issues (e.g., security holds or verification problems) can trigger errors.

How to Fix Robinhood Server Errors
1. Check If Robinhood Is Down
Before troubleshooting, determine whether the issue is on Robinhood’s end. Visit websites like Downdetector or Robinhood’s official status page to check for reported outages.
2. Restart the App or Website
Close and reopen the Robinhood app or refresh the web page to see if the error persists.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ve minor glitches.
3. Update the App
Ensure you have the latest version of the Robinhood app installed. Updates often include bug fixes that can resolve server errors.
4. Check Your Internet Connection
A weak or intermittent internet connection can cause server errors. Try switching from Wi-Fi to mobile data (or vice versa) or resetting your router.
5. Clear Cache and Data
If you’re using the mobile app, clearing the cache and data can help resolve performance issues:
- On Android: Go to Settings > Apps > Robinhood > Storage > Clear Cache & Clear Data.
- On iOS: Uninstall and reinstall the app to clear cache and temporary files.
6. Log Out and Log Back In
Sometimes, signing out of your account and logging back in can refresh your session and resolve server errors.
7. Try a Different Device
If possible, try accessing Robinhood from another device or a different web browser to see if the problem persists.
8. Contact Robinhood Support
If none of the above steps work, reaching out to Robinhood’s customer support is the best option. You can contact them through the app or their official website.
